Output 3ca8c89181636a68e7ef2978f45251fc7d99938230688582f55fe71e5c44e3ed:62

value
27615
script pubkey
OP_0 OP_PUSHBYTES_32 09b91de0c7748d750dda4b786cd62c97faf72046a57040e4c2f84518fe4c4afe
address
bc1qpxu3mcx8wjxh2rw6fduxe43vjla0wgzx54cypexzlpz33ljvftlqtsd7zk
transaction
3ca8c89181636a68e7ef2978f45251fc7d99938230688582f55fe71e5c44e3ed
spent
true